타입은 Long Type 인데.. 오라클 10g 미만 버젼에선 쿼리가 너무 긴경우 이를 처리하지 못한다.
그래서 미리 변수에 닮아놓고..
쿼리는 변수를 호출해서 쓰는 방식..
DECLARE test_aa t_plan.short_desc%TYPE;
BEGIN test_aa:='~~~~~~~~~~~~~~~긴.. 내용.. ~~~~~~~~~~~ (')는 들어가지 않는다.';
UPDATE t_plan SET short_desc = test_aa
WHERE plan_no='10328';
END;
COMMIT;
'Db > Oracle' 카테고리의 다른 글
oracle start with, connect by (3) | 2010.04.09 |
---|---|
oracle INTERSECT & MINUS (2) | 2010.04.09 |
oracle dual > connect by level 사용으로 수치값 출력 (3) | 2010.04.09 |
ORACLE PIVOT sample (5) | 2010.04.07 |
Oracle cursor 간단 sample (1) | 2010.04.06 |